I found this whilst browsing round the net. The KNVB has decided to make the Jupiler League smaller so have written to FC Eindhoven and just told them to leave.

It seems like breathtaking arrogance from the KNVB. Has this recieved much publicity in Holland? The only comparison I can think of was with East Stirling in Scotland (where they also don't have relegation out of the league) but I don't think that was ever a serious proposition, they were just told it may be considered if they didn't improve (I think at the time they had just finished bottom for the 3rd year running with 8 points). Surely if the KNVB want to refresh the league there are better ways than this to go about it!

SE6Ajacied schreef:Has this recieved much publicity in Holland?
Hardly at all, to be honest... I didn't even know, but this is scandalous...

I do believe something must be done about the First Division. In a 'healthy' football league, ever First Division club should have the ambition to get promoted to the top flight. In the Dutch First Division, however, only seven or eight clubs have that ambition: they have the potential budget, the fanbase and the stadium for it. At least seven or eight other clubs, however, are too sad to get promoted. In fact: imagine that a club like FC Eindhoven or Stormvogels Telstar would suddenly have a great crop of ambitious youth player - and win the title... They would have a massive problem and they would probably go bankrupt.

That's a bizarre situation: almost 50% of the First Division couldn't even play in the Eredivisie because of their tiny, ramshackle old grounds, where the police would never allow them to play Ajax or Feyenoord.

So yeah - something must be done. A pyramid system would be ideal: it should be possible to get relegated from the First Division. My prediction is that some of the clubs would fall quite deeply, and possibly go out of business. Many 'amateur' clubs from the Hoofdklasse are much healthier (financially) and, in some cases, have better facilities and get larger crowds. Clubs like ADO '20 (from Heemskerk), Quick Boys (from Katwijk), IJsselmeervogels (from Spakenburg) and Rijnsburgse Boys could very easily replace TOP Oss, FC Eindhoven, Stormvogels Telstar and FC Omniworld, to name but a few, cos they're "bigger clubs" in many ways.

But... this is not the way. You can't just send a club a letter, asking them to leave the league and go away. That's bollocks and not the way a 99 year-old club that won the Dutch title in the past should be treated.
